allsid said:Trixie_Belle missoula here- that class looks fun! Who taught it and do you know if it will be offered again soon? Cheers-allsidI've attended 2 classes: 6 hour smoking and grilling class, AKA the 101 and the 201 advanced BBQ class (yesterday). Erin taught the first class, Cam the 2nd. Both men seemed to know their stuff.
It's not mandatory to complete the 101 class before taking the 201, especially if you have some experience already.
Here's the website: http://seattlebbqandgrillingschool.com/
Look here too: http://www.bbqandgrillingstore.com/seattle/
They hold classes in Seattle, Vancouver, WA and a couple of other locations. Their website isn't the best, but poke around and you'll find lots of info.BGE novice...A Southern Belle living in Seattle. -
